You ran the ads. Got the click. The customer checked out, placed a COD order, and you shipped it. But the address was slightly off, or nobody picked up the door, and two weeks later the package is back on your shelf.
You paid to acquire them. You paid to ship there. You paid to ship back. And you made nothing. That's an RTO, and for most Indian D2C brands, it happens constantly.

So why does it keep happening?
It's not that customers are bad or couriers are careless. It's that most of the damage is already done by the time anyone notices.
Bad Addresses
Customers type fast at checkout. A missing lane, a wrong pincode, and the courier is lost. Nobody caught it before it shipped.
Unreachable Customers
One missed call and the delivery is marked failed. No follow-up, no WhatsApp nudge. The order just comes back.
Manual Everything
Tracking, rerouting, calling customers. All handled by people on WhatsApp threads. It works at 100 orders. It breaks at 10,000.
